package main
import (
"reflect"
"github.com/hashicorp/terraform-plugin-sdk/helper/schema"
elastic7 "github.com/olivere/elastic/v7"
elastic5 "gopkg.in/olivere/elastic.v5"
elastic6 "gopkg.in/olivere/elastic.v6"
)
func dataSourceElasticsearchHost() *schema.Resource {
return &schema.Resource{
Read: dataSourceElasticsearchHostRead,
Schema: map[string]*schema.Schema{
"active": &schema.Schema{
Type: schema.TypeBool,
Required: true,
},
"url": &schema.Schema{
Type: schema.TypeString,
Computed: true,
},
},
}
}
func dataSourceElasticsearchHostRead(d *schema.ResourceData, m interface{}) error {
// The upstream elastic client does not export the property for the urls
// it's using. Presumably the URLS would be available where the client is
// intantiated, but in terraform, that's not always practicable.
var err error
switch m.(type) {
case *elastic7.Client:
client := m.(*elastic7.Client)
urls := reflect.ValueOf(client).Elem().FieldByName("urls")
if urls.Len() > 0 {
d.SetId(urls.Index(0).String())
}
case *elastic6.Client:
client := m.(*elastic6.Client)
urls := reflect.ValueOf(client).Elem().FieldByName("urls")
if urls.Len() > 0 {
d.SetId(urls.Index(0).String())
}
default:
client := m.(*elastic5.Client)
urls := reflect.ValueOf(client).Elem().FieldByName("urls")
if urls.Len() > 0 {
d.SetId(urls.Index(0).String())
}
}
return err
}
